Truth and Deceit: Media Relations and Military Deception.

Abstract

The Joint Force Commander (JFC)can conduct "good faith" media relations in operations that involve operational deception by directing early coordination between Command and Control Warfare (C2W) and the Public Affairs Officer (PAO) . PADs must ensure that the legitimate professional interests of news media are addressed as well as the operational needs of the JFC in operational planning. To plan for future operations, military leaders must understand evolving DOD policy on media relations, recognize the changing role of of PADs, and update joint doctrine to provide guidance on PAO/C2W coordination.
